1979 Audi 80 vs. 2003 Toyota Echo
To start off, 2003 Toyota Echo is newer by 24 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1979 Audi 80.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1979 Audi 80 would be higher. At 1,496 cc (4 cylinders), 2003 Toyota Echo is equipped with a bigger engine.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2003 Toyota Echo weights approximately 100 kg more than 1979 Audi 80.
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control.
